public void Ok()
        {
            var cmd = new GetFundraiserCommand().GetFundraiser("1", "1");

            Assert.IsTrue(cmd.Status == CommandStatus.DONE);
            Assert.IsTrue(cmd.Output != null);
        }
Beispiel #2
0
        /// <summary>
        /// Entry point to display donation form
        /// </summary>
        /// <param name="organismReference"></param>
        /// <param name="fundraiserReference"></param>
        public void DisplayDonationForm(string organismReference, string fundraiserReference)
        {
            var fundraiser = new GetFundraiserCommand().GetFundraiser(organismReference, fundraiserReference);

            if (fundraiser.Status != CommandStatus.DONE)
            {
                Console.ForegroundColor = ConsoleColor.Red;
                Console.WriteLine("Error: " + fundraiser.Message);
                Console.ResetColor();
            }

            this._model.Fundraiser = fundraiser.Output;

            DisplayStep1();
        }
        public void KoIfNotFound()
        {
            var cmd = new GetFundraiserCommand().GetFundraiser("1", "unknow_ref");

            Assert.IsTrue(cmd.Status == CommandStatus.NOT_FOUND);
        }
        public void KoIfNull()
        {
            var cmd = new GetFundraiserCommand().GetFundraiser(null, null);

            Assert.IsTrue(cmd.Status == CommandStatus.BAD_PARAMETER);
        }